The first Jeep and Dodge electric vehicles will hit the US later this year. Ahead of their official launches, Stellantis revealed the new STLA Large EV platform that will underpin the upcoming Jeep and Dodge EVs. The platform features up to 500 miles range and power “that will outperform any of the existing Hellcat V-8s.”

The Tesla Model Y officially took the crown as Europe’s best-selling car overall for 2023, making it the first electric vehicle ever to do so. While the Model Y had taken the spot for a few months last year, year-end results were a close call with a very different vehicle: the ubiquitous ICE hatchback Dacia Sandero, tightly priced at $13,051 (€12,000).
